We started bringing our sweet dog Kazzy to Balanced Pet over a year ago when it was still called Big Valley Vet. Without a doubt Dr. Watson is the best veterinarian we have ever found for our girl. For starters Kazzy absolutely loves going. Her tail wags, she doesn't shake, and she loves Dr Watson! Dr Watson talks to Kazzy and greets her like she's the most important one in the room! The exam rooms are set up to make the dog feel as comfortable as possible with comfy mats on the floor instead of a big scary metal table. I love the holistic approach that Dr Watson takes. She combines the best of Western medicine with alternative practices and philosophies. Just what I have been looking for for Kazzy for years!! So relieved we finally found her!
